WHY HUMANS HOLD ON TO MEMORIES

January 14, 2026

Memories play a central role in how people understand themselves and the world around them. From childhood moments to defining adult experiences, memories help shape identity, values, and emotional responses. Psychologically, remembering is not just about recalling facts; it is about preserving meaning. When people cherish memories, they are often holding on to feelings of safety, belonging, pride, or love that were present at the time those moments were formed.

The brain prioritizes emotionally charged experiences, which is why certain memories remain vivid long after others fade. This emotional connection explains why people revisit old stories, photographs, or familiar places during moments of reflection or transition. Cherishing memories offers comfort and continuity in an ever-changing world.

Nostalgia and Emotional Well-Being

Nostalgia was once viewed as a negative emotion, associated with homesickness or longing for the past. Modern psychology, however, recognizes nostalgia as a powerful emotional tool. Reflecting on positive past experiences can boost mood, reduce stress, and even counter feelings of loneliness. When people feel disconnected or uncertain, nostalgic memories can act as emotional anchors.

Cherished memories often resurface during life changes, such as career shifts, relationships ending, or personal loss. Revisiting meaningful moments helps reinforce a sense of self and reminds individuals of their resilience. Nostalgia is not about escaping the present; it is about using the past to strengthen emotional stability in the present.

Memory, Identity, and Personal Narrative

People naturally build stories about who they are, and memories form the foundation of those narratives. The mind does not store memories as isolated events, but weaves them into an ongoing personal story. Cherishing memories is a way of maintaining coherence in that story, ensuring that past experiences still have relevance.

Shared memories, especially from formative years, play a key role in social identity. Looking back at a school yearbook, for example, often reconnects people with earlier versions of themselves, reminding them of friendships, ambitions, and defining moments. These reflections reinforce a sense of continuity, showing how far someone has come while validating where they started.

The Role of Memory Triggers

Objects, scents, sounds, and images can all act as memory triggers. A familiar song might instantly transport someone to a specific moment in time, while a photograph can revive emotions thought long forgotten. These triggers work because memory is closely tied to sensory processing. The brain links experiences with sensory details, making them powerful cues for recall.

People often intentionally preserve memory triggers by keeping mementos or revisiting familiar media. This behavior is not accidental; it is a psychological effort to preserve emotional experiences that still hold meaning. Memory triggers allow people to revisit emotions safely, without reliving negative consequences tied to those moments.

Why Letting Go Can Feel Difficult

Cherishing memories can sometimes make letting go feel challenging. When a memory represents happiness, connection, or purpose, releasing it can feel like losing part of oneself. Psychologically, this is because memories are tied to emotional needs. They remind people of times when those needs were met.

However, holding memories does not mean living in the past. Healthy reflection allows individuals to appreciate experiences without becoming stuck in them. The key difference lies in whether memories are used to inform growth or to avoid the present.

Cherishing Memories as a Healthy Practice

When approached with balance, cherishing memories supports emotional well-being and personal growth. Reflecting on meaningful moments can foster gratitude, strengthen relationships, and encourage self-compassion. It helps people recognize patterns in their lives, learn from past decisions, and appreciate their journey.

Ultimately, the psychology behind cherishing memories reveals a deep human desire for meaning, connection, and continuity. By honoring the past without being defined by it, people can carry their memories forward as sources of strength rather than limitation.
